How do I give my talk?
For AAS 244, all iPoster presenters will be featured in the iPoster Gallery.
NOTE: iPoster authors do not give Oral talks.
In-person presenters will present their iPoster during the designated Highlight iPoster Sessions in the Exhibit Hall in Madison, Wisconsin. iPoster authors speak about their posters by standing next to the designated iPoster terminals in the exhibit hall.
Remote presenters will build their iPoster and it will be available in the iPoster Gallery. It is strongly suggested that presenters add narration to their posters.
All iPoster authors will also be able to participate in discussions on Slack regarding their iPoster.
